Number Theory Course
Dive into number theory essentials like modular arithmetic, prime numbers, Euler’s theorem, and RSA cryptography. This course connects solid mathematical proofs with practical encryption techniques, key creation, and security protocols, perfect for maths experts aiming for advanced real-world applications and deeper knowledge.

What will I learn?
This course provides a structured journey through divisibility, modular arithmetic, primes, Euler’s totient function, Euler’s theorem, RSA encryption processes including key generation, encoding, decoding, security measures, and best practices, with emphasis on rigorous proofs, practical calculations, and professional report presentation.
